Have you seen the Progress at Vino Piazza?

For those of you interested in the continued progress of the Vino Piazza, this update should be quite exciting!

We continue to chip away at the enormous but shrinking list of tasks required to declare this project officially open to the public.

We have developed a small garden area with a trellis system, landscaping and picnic tables for our guests. We have installed two fountains, complete with fish, and are working on a third as you read!

The Courtyard continues to shape up, as we prepare the deck for ease of access to the three stunningly decorated tasting rooms on its perimeter. Also off the Courtyard is the future deli that is scheduled for operation in the late Fall months. Outdoor dining and picnic areas will also be available in the Courtyard.

Work also continues on our Visitor's Center, where guests will be able obtain information about the facility, and particularly about the ViP Wine Group members. Additionally, this is where you'll be able to view our full-sized cast replicas of the heads of Stan, the Tyrannasaurus Rex, and Niel, the Triceratops, in addition to other world-class specimens of natural history. It is also the location you will be able to obtain your complimentary ViP Wine List, a comprehensive wine list and price guide of the ViP Wine Group members! These lists are scheduled to release by July 27, so be sure to stop by and ask for yours!

And the wines are developing right along with everything else. Many wines have found their way into the bottle and are settling in for their debut releases!
